Subject: LotSense occupancy feed — v2.9 published

Hi all,

The v2.9 occupancy feed for the Brindle Garage network is now live on the release channel. Plugin authors should note that the stall-status enum gained a RESERVED value; unknown values must be passed through, not dropped. Schema docs are updated in the portal. For compatibility checks, pin your integration against the build token below.

session token of kawip-bahaf = htk9_8600e190b

Handover — Sam to Io. Quick note on the shared lab at Greyholt Annex: we split it with the Pellar team now, so contractors need to book bench time on the corridor sheet before starting. Their centrifuge is off-limits, ours is the one by the window. Keep the fume hood closed overnight, they've complained twice. Waste bins go out Fridays. The lab door was rekeyed last month, so the current entry code is below.

staff pass of kawip-hawef = bdg-QLP-2

Leadership Review Briefing — Ostermill Site Lease

Negotiations with Pellwright Estates on the Ostermill warehouse lease have reached a decisive stage. The landlord has offered a seven-year renewal at a 9% uplift, against our target of 4%, with a break clause at year four. Facilities has modelled relocation costs and they remain prohibitive. The confidential rationale for our fallback position is set out below.

internal memo for kawip-hadug: Headcount on the Wenwyn team goes from 7 to 140 by the end of January. Gross margin on Wenwyn came in at 20 percent against a plan of 15 percent.

# Pagination constants for the Fernwick public API.
#
# Heads up: these caps exist because one integration once asked for
# page_size=100000 and took down the read replica in Dunmore. Cursors
# expire after the TTL below, so clients hammering stale cursors get a
# 410, not a retry storm. If you're on call and latency spikes on the
# /listings endpoint, nudge the defaults down before touching the DB.
# Bump these only with a load test. Current values:

tuning table, yajog-yahof:
BUDGETS = {
    "lamvan": 303,
    "wenox": 460,
    "fenvan": 525,
}